About Me

It is my dream to become a nurse. My inspiration for this career was taking care of my grandmother back in Jamaica. She had dementia and I kept her company at all times and made her feel wanted and comfortable. I love caregiving because I treat my clients just like my family members. I love working with the elderly in general. As a caregiver, I involve my clients in their care routine, as long as they can choose for themselves, and if not I try my best to make them as comfortable as possible with my service. I am loving and I like to have fun. I love to cleanliness and always make sure that my clients and their surroundings are neat and clean. In my spare time, I love to go shopping, especially for interior decorations.

Recommendations

I am happy to recommended Grace -- she has been great with my mom. She worked with us for about six months until Spring of 2020, when we my mom moved into a nursing home. Grace is so knowledgeable about the medications my mom is taking and she has a lot of experience with patients with Parkinson’s disease. My mother has lost interest in doing the things she used to like to do. Grace keeps her busy by playing games, doing puzzles, and doing her hair and makeup. She makes sure my mom is safe. Grace gives us excellent advice about how to care for a senior and I am thankful to LeanOnWe for helping us hire Grace.

- Stephanie B., LeanOnWe Customer, New York

I was planning to travel out of the country January 2017 and my mother, in her late 80s, needed a companion and caretaker to stay over as she lived alone. It was mostly for peace of mind for me and my husband, as we lived downstairs from my mom and took care of her. My mother, at the time, was ambulatory and cognitively intact. She had COPD, lung cancer, diabetes, hypertension, severe arthritis, and a pacemaker. My priority was to have a medically astute caretaker who was strong, personable, and kind. Grace possessed all of these qualities and she was reliable, warm, loving, and as an added bonus, she had a sense of humor. Grace stayed with my mom whenever we went away that year and whenever she was hospitalized for various reasons. Grace was with her 4 nights a week and sometimes more. She cared for her, befriended her, treated her with dignity, and kept her clean, comfortable, well fed and most importantly happy. She truly cared for her. It brought a smile to my mother's face whenever Grace arrived, no matter the physical or emotional battle she was facing. I would trust Grace to take care of any family member; she became a friend and lifeline to me. I don't think I would have survived the unfortunate ordeal my mother faced without her. Grace very lovingly called my mom, "Mommalu," and I will never forget how well she took care of her and also made sure we had the right help when she couldn't be with her. She coordinated and staffed my mother's 24/7 care. Any family would be fortunate to have Grace in their life when the going gets rough and they need support.

- Tina W., New York

I have known Grace since 2009. She was hired to be the home health aide for my brother, later for my father, and then for my mother. All were in terminally ill situations. She has also, from time to time, assisted in caring for my husband. For all of these years and with each member of my family, Grace has been an outstanding and dedicated caretaker. She assisted in bathing, dressing, feeding, and all aspects of daily life that were struggles for my family members. She was and remains caring, congenial, reliable, responsible, and very professional in all interactions with the patient and other family members. She is a beautiful person, inside and out, and I can't compliment her enough. Grace has an amazing attitude and interacts beautifully with everyone. She is an absolute joy to work with and I highly recommend her.

- Nancy I., New York
